Selenium analogues of 2-(thiopyran-4-ylidene)-1,3-dithiole as novel unsymmetrical electron donors

Abstract

The selenium analogues of 2-(thiopyran-4-ylidene)-1,3-dithiole and its 4,5-bis(methylthio) and 4,5-(ethylenedithio) derivatives have been prepared as a new series of unsymmetrical electron donors; some of their complexes with 7,7,8,8-tetracyanoquinodimethane are electrically highly conductive.
